Cycling has become increasingly popular among people of all ages and fitness levels. For beginners, the vast array of biking equipment can be overwhelming, particularly when it comes to understanding the bike's suspension system. The suspension system plays a crucial role in how a bike performs, affecting comfort, control, and overall riding experience. It is essential for new cyclists to familiarize themselves with the basic components and functions of bike suspension, as this knowledge can enhance their cycling journey and promote a safer, more enjoyable ride.       The bike's suspension system is primarily designed to absorb shocks from rough terrain, ensuring a smoother ride while enhancing control and stability. There are different types of suspension systems, each with its own advantages and disadvantages.
